Hi all :)
I installed Systems Insight Manager 4.1 for windows 2000 sp4.
When i try to install the ProLiant Support Pack on the managed system by choosing "Deploy->Deploy Drivers,Firmware and Agents->Initial ProLiant Support Pack Install" and selecting the OS, i have this error "Error retrieving catalog. Be sure a trust relationship is established with the repository device." in the "Step 3: Select a Windows Support Pack" page.
PMP 3.0 is already install with T2415BA_4.01.00_Win packge downloaded on http://h18004.www1.hp.com/products/servers/management/hpsim/index.html
Thnak u for your help

Solution
On your SIM server...open up the System Management homepage (the port :2301\2381 view of the server). Once you are there, go to the settings tab and the click the Options link at the bottom. Scroll down about halfway and you will see where you can setup Trust. Even though SIM is installed on this server... Trust is not automatically assumed. You can choose for the server to "trust itself" by one of three methods:
Trust All
Trust by Name
Trust by Certficate
Once you've done that...go back to the SIM application and go to the Logs tab, View All Scheduled Tasks and run the Daily Device I.D. task and the SNMP Polling Task for Servers task.
The trust relationship takes a little while to finally show up under SIM, but that should get you going.
